USF’s Nasello Selected to USWNT U-20 Roster For Pre-Qualifying Training Camp
TAMPA, Fla., Jan. 9, 2020 – University of South Florida women's soccer forward
Sydny Nasello was chosen as one of 25 participants for the United States' Women's National Team U-20 pre-qualifying training camp, USA Soccer announced. New U-20 coach Laura Harvey selected the 25-member training camp roster in preparations for upcoming championships.
"Sydny is on the path she is meant to take," head coach
Denise Schilte-Brown said. "It is a joy to be a part of her remarkable journey!"
Nasello finished her 2019 season with the Bulls with two goals and 10 assists for 14 points. She had the highest point total among those who will return to the roster in 2020. She was selected as second team American Athletic All-Conference in a season where the Bulls reached the Sweet 16 for the first time in program history.
The Land O' Lakes, Fla., native was selected to the AAC all-tournament team after assisting three of USF's four goals to win the conference tournament.
After the camp, Harvey will choose the 20-player roster for the 2020 CONCACAF Women's U-20 Championship, which runs from Feb. 15-March 1 in the Dominican Republic. The 2020 FIFA U-20 World Cup will be held in Panama and Costa Rica this August.
This is Nasello's second recent call to the USWNT program. In December, the sophomore participated in the 2019 Nike International Friendlies, where she played in games against France and Brazil.

The USF women's soccer team has posted eight consecutive seasons of 10-plus wins and nine in the last 10 years under head coach Denise Schilte-Brown. The Bulls made their first NCAA tournament appearance in 2010 and returned in 2014, 2015, 2017, 2018 and 2019.
